Light sensing has been extensively characterized in the human pathogen Acinetobacter baumannii at environmental temperatures. However, the influence of light on the physiology and pathogenicity of human bacterial pathogens at temperatures found in warm-blooded hosts is still poorly understand. In this work, we show that Staphylococcus aureus, Acinetobacter baumannii, and Pseudomonas aeruginosa (ESKAPE) priority pathogens, which have been recognized by the WHO and the CDC as critical, can also sense and respond to light at temperatures found in human hosts. Most interestingly, in these pathogens, light modulates important pathogenicity determinants as well as virulence in an epithelial infection model, which could have implications in human infections. In fact, we found that alpha-toxin-dependent hemolysis, motility, and growth under iron-deprived conditions are modulated by light in S. aureus Light also regulates persistence, metabolism, and the ability to kill competitors in some of these microorganisms. Finally, light exerts a profound effect on the virulence of these pathogens in an epithelial infection model, although the response is not the same in the different species; virulence was enhanced by light in A. baumannii and S. aureus, while in A. nosocomialis and P. aeruginosa it was reduced. Neither the BlsA photoreceptor nor the type VI secretion system (T6SS) is involved in virulence modulation by light in A. baumannii Overall, this fundamental knowledge highlights the potential use of light to control pathogen virulence, either directly or by manipulating the light regulatory switch toward the lowest virulence/persistence configuration.IMPORTANCE Pathogenic bacteria are microorganisms capable of producing disease. Dangerous bacterial pathogens, such as Staphylococcus aureus, Pseudomonas aeruginosa, and Acinetobacter baumannii, are responsible for serious intrahospital and community infections in humans. Therapeutics is often complicated due to resistance to multiple antibiotics, rendering them ineffective. In this work, we show that these pathogens sense natural light and respond to it by modulating aspects related to their ability to cause disease; in the presence of light, some of them become more aggressive, while others show an opposite response. Overall, we provide new understanding on the behavior of these pathogens, which could contribute to the control of infections caused by them. Since the response is distributed in diverse pathogens, this notion could prove a general concept.

It is known that pigs can acquire flavour preferences by brief social interactions with conspecifics that previously consumed a flavoured solid feed. However, there is no information about whether a flavoured solution could support flavour preferences through social transmission. Ninety-six pigs (49 days old) were housed in 12 pens (8 pigs/pen). Four animals per pen were randomly selected to act as observers and four as demonstrators. Demonstrator animals were temporarily moved to an empty pen where a protein solution was offered (porcine digestive peptides (PDPs), 4% weight/volume) with the addition of 0.075% aniseed (six pens) or garlic (six pens) powdered artificial flavours for 30 min. Afterwards, demonstrators were returned to interact with observer animals for 30 min. A choice test (30 min) between aniseed and garlic PDP was performed for each observer group after the interaction. Observers showed a higher intake of solutions previously consumed by their demonstrator conspecifics (648 v. 468 ml; SEM 61.36, P < 0.05). As with flavoured solid feeds, protein solutions containing artificial flavours can create preferences in pigs for those flavours through social transmission from conspecifics.

Carbon nanotubes (CNT) can be chemically modified by doping or functionalization to change the chemical and surface properties. These characteristic makes to CNT candidates for multiple applications including medical field in cardiovascular area. A novel method to CNT functionalization by formation of two compounds: α-bromoacid and the organic compound 2-(methacryloyloxy) ethyl phosphorylcholine (MPC), will be discussed in this article. According to results, CNT are suggested like candidates to repel oxidized low-density lipoproteins (ox-LDL) to prevent restenosis. The electronegative character on surface of functionalized CNT (F-CNT) is shown by wettability analysis observing a repellent behaviour in contact with ox-LDL after functionalization route. Here we analyse the toxicity of CNT and F-CNT on HepG2 cell line and find no damage to the cell membrane of HepG2 cells in concentration at doses below 1mg/ml.

PURPOSE: To evaluate an institute-specific CTV-PTV margin for head and neck (HN) patients according to a 3-mm action level protocol. METHODS/PATIENTS: Twenty-three HN patients were prospectively analysed. Patients were immobilized with a thermoplastic mask. Inter- and intrafractional set-up errors (in the three dimensions) were assessed from portal images (PI) registration. Digitally reconstructed radiographs (DRRs) were compared with two orthogonal PI by matching bone anatomy landmarks. The isocenter was verified during the first five consecutive days of treatment: if the mean error detected was greater than 2 mm the isocenter position was corrected for the rest of the treatment. Isocenter was checked weekly thereafter. Set-up images were obtained before and after treatment administration on 10, 20 and 30 fractions to quantify the intrafractional displacement. For the set-up errors, systematic (Σ), random (σ), overall standard deviations, and the overall mean displacement (M), were determined. CTV to PTV margin was calculated considering both inter- and intrafractional errors. RESULTS: A total of 396 portal images was analysed in 23 patients. Systematic interfractional (Σ(inter)) set-up errors ranged between 0.77 and 1.42 mm in the three directions, whereas the random (σ (inter)) errors were around 1-1.31 mm. Systematic intrafractional (Σ(intra)) errors ranged between 0.65 and 1.11 mm, whereas the random (σ (intra)) errors were around 1.13-1.16 mm. CONCLUSIONS: A verification protocol (3-mm action level) provided by EPIDs improves the set-up accuracy. Intrafractional error is not negligible and contributes to create a larger CTV-PTV margin. The appropriate CTV-PTV margin for our institute is between 3 and 4.5 mm considering both inter- and intrafractional errors.

Activation of H(+) secretion in the intracellular canaliculi of parietal cells occurs on an unknown time scale with ill-defined kinetics for the coupling of H(+) secretion and the elevation of intracellular calcium ([Ca(2+)](i)) stimulated by secretagogues. 2. We developed a method to determine H(+) secretion in isolated rabbit gastric glands with spatio-temporal resolution, using the fluorescent indicator Lysosensor Yellow-Blue (LYB). Glands accumulated the dye exclusively in the intracellular canaliculi of parietal cells and the gland lumen. Dye fluorescence in the acid spaces of the glands increased upon stimulation of acid secretion by carbachol, histamine and forskolin. Simultaneous fluorescence measurements of acid secretion and [Ca(2+)](i) at 1 s resolution were made by joint loading of LYB and Fluo-3. 3. Carbachol-stimulated H(+) secretion was detected in the gland lumen as early as 3 s after the onset of the [Ca(2+)](i) spike. H(+) accumulation appeared to be transient and paralleled the release component of the [Ca(2+)](i) spike. Short and repetitive stimulations with carbachol elicited repetitive responses in [Ca(2+)](i) and H(+) secretion. 4. Histamine or forskolin stimulated H(+) secretion with a delayed onset (around 2 min) and a sustained response. Acid secretion was temporally unrelated to the oscillatory Ca(2+) responses. 5. The striking difference in the kinetics of activation of H(+) secretion by cholinergic and cAMP-dependent secretagogues indicates that two distinct mechanisms are operating in the final stimulation of the pump, in spite of both eliciting a [Ca(2+)](i) response.

Palm kernel meal (PKM), a by-product from the African Palm oil industry that is extensively cultivated in tropical countries, is an interesting feed ingredient for poultry due to its availability and low cost. The objective of this study was to evaluate the use of different levels of PKM in layer diets. This particular PKM contained 9.70% crude protein, 0.20% methionine, 0.36% lysine, and a TMEn value of 2,254 kcal/kg. A control diet based on corn and soybean meal and five different levels of PKM added to it were fed to Single Comb White Leghorn hens from 18 to 38 wk of age. The PKM levels were 0, 10, 20, 30, 40, and 50%. The hens were housed three per cage (30.5 cm wide x 45.7 cm deep). The six treatments were assigned randomly to three contiguous cages in each of eight rows in a randomized complete block design. Egg production was recorded daily, and feed consumption for an entire week was recorded every 21 d. Egg weight and specific gravity were recorded for 3 consecutive d every 21 d. Mortality was recorded daily. Results show that egg production was significantly decreased (P < 0.05) only with 50% PKM in the diet. Feed conversion was not affected by any level of PKM. Specific gravity was slightly but significantly (P < 0.05) decreased by all levels of added PKM. Feed consumption, mortality, and egg weight did not differ significantly among the treatments. We concluded that this particular PKM may be used up to 40% in the diet, taking into account that specific gravity may be slightly decreased.

Some viruses induce changes in membrane permeability during infection. We have shown previously that the porcine strain of rotavirus, OSU, induced an increase in the permeability to Na+, K+, and Ca2+ during replication in MA104 cells. In this work, we have characterized the divalent cation entry pathway by measuring intracellular Ca2+ in fura-2-loaded MA104 and HT29 cells in suspension. The permeability to Ca2+ and other cations was evaluated by the change of the intracellular concentration following an extracellular cation pulse. Rotavirus infection induced an increase in permeability to Ca2+, Ba2+, Sr2+, Mn2+, and Co2+. The rate of cation entry decreased over time as the intracellular concentration increased during the first 20 s. This indicates that regulatory mechanisms, including channel inactivation, are triggered. La3+ did not enter the cell and blocked the entry of the divalent cations in a dose-dependent manner. Metoxyverapamil (D600), a blocker of L-type voltage-gated channels, partially inhibited the entry of Ca2+ in virus-infected MA104 and HT29 cells. The results suggest that rotavirus infection of cultured cells activates a cation channel rather than nonspecific permeation through the plasma membrane. This activation involves the synthesis of viral proteins through mechanisms yet unknown. The increase in intracellular Ca2+ induced by the activation of this channel may be related to the increase in cytoplasmic and endoplasmic reticulum Ca2+ pools required for virus maturation and cell death.

The Venezuelan Food Composition Table (VFCT) is being revised for the publication of the ninth edition within the Venezuelan Food Project. The majority of the RE values for plant foods given in the VFCT were taken from previous editions (1964-1973) and with few exceptions, still remains the same in the latest edition of 1994. These values were calculated from the total carotenoid content of food, determined by an open column method with no separation of the various carotenoids that might be present in the food. Recently it has been suggested that the accepted factors to convert beta-carotene and other carotenoids to RE (1/6 and 1/12, respectively) do not reflect the reality and the apparent mean vitamin A activity of leafy vegetables and carrot would be around 23% and fruits about 50% of that assumed until now. Percentages of the Venezuelan RDAs for vitamin A were calculated from vitamin A intake supplied by food consumption surveys, using the conversion factors corrected according to the above mentioned criteria. Percentages of the Venezuelan RDAs were again calculated with the vitamin A availability given by the Food Balance Sheet (1997), using two levels of RE in carrots: 2,800 ER and 850 ER. Results in these approaches differ markedly and indicate that the vitamin A nutrition status may be overestimated. If confirmed, this situation could influence the criteria and decisions in regard to food fortification and other strategies for controlling vitamin A deficiency.

Rotavirus infection modifies the metabolism and ionic homeostasis of the host cell. First, there is an induction of viral synthesis with a parallel shutoff of cell protein production, followed by an increase of plasma membrane Ca2+ permeability, thereby inducing an increase of free cytoplasmic and sequestered Ca2+ concentrations. Cell death follows at a later stage. We studied the role of the increase in Ca2+ concentration in cell death. An elevation of extracellular Ca2+ concentration during infection induced an increase in [Ca2+]i and potentiated cell death. Buffering the increases in [Ca2+]i with BAPTA added at 6 h p.i. reduced the cytopathic effect without inhibiting viral protein synthesis and infectious particle production. Metoxyverapamil (D600), a Ca2+ channel inhibitor, added at 1 h p.i. reduced Ca2+ permeability, the increases in [Ca2+]i, and cell death produced by infection without modifying viral protein synthesis and infectious titer. Thapsigargin, the inhibitor of Ca(2+)-ATPase of endoplasmic reticulum, potentiated the increase of [Ca2+]i and accelerated the time course of cell death. Double staining with fluorescein diacetate and ethidium bromide or acridine orange and ethidium bromide showed that infected MA104 cells had lost plasma membrane integrity without DNA fragmentation or formation of apoptotic bodies. These results support the hypothesis that the increase in [Ca2+]i due to a product of viral protein synthesis triggers the chain of events that leads to cell death by oncosis.

UNLABELLED: Morbi-mortality due to asthma has increased in recent years both throughout the world in Cuba. A study of mortality caused by this disease has conducted in order to describe its current trend in the country. METHOD: A time series study was conducted which included all deaths attributed to asthma in Cuba recorded in the vital statistics records of the Ministry of Public Health from 1972 to 1993. Rates, secular trends of general mortality and according to gender were estimated. The proportional mortality for the 1972-1993 period was calculated and the potential years of life lost during the 90-92 trienium were quantified. RESULTS AND DISCUSSION: A drop in these global rates occurred between 1972 and 1975, with values of 3.6; 4.1; 3.0; 2.2; respectively; possibly due to the introduction of disodic chromoglycate among other drugs and the beginning of the Asthmatic Patient Program. An later increase in mortality was observed until 1993 (5.9 x 100,000 inhabitants) which may attributed to a drop of the intensity and regularity of said program and to other internationally knowledge factors which are present in our country. The trend of general mortality rose during this period and was greater in females than in males; which means that the risk to die of this cause has increased. Proportional Mortality since 1980 (0.50%) also increased until 1993 (0.80%). Potential years of life lost due to premature death ranged from 5,646 in 1990 to 7,386 in 1992. The increase in proportional mortality and the potential years of life lost suggest that this disease should been given priority by the National Health Program as a preventable cause of death, especially in women. CONCLUSIONS: There is a rising trend of mortality among asthmatic patients during the period under consideration. Asthma is a cause of premature death in Cuba.

The pure TdI-1 polypeptide that blocks miniature endplate potentials (MEPPs) and abolishes or reduces endplate potentials (EPPs) below the action potential threshold was identified from the crude fraction of Tityus discrepans venom. The toxin is a potent reversible non-depolarizing muscle relaxant that blocks more than 95% of the EPP at a 2 microM (0.1 mg/ml) concentration. On a molar basis, TdI-1 is as potent as or more potent than many muscle relaxants since, at the concentration used, the toxin suppressed more than 95% of the EPP. Using matrix-assisted laser desorption time of flight (MALD-TOF) ionization mass spectrometry, TdI-1 was found to have an unusally large mol. wt for a scorpion toxin, close to 48,000. The N-terminal sequence of the first 23 residues of TdI-1 was also determined. The fragment differs from the N-terminal sequences of all 140 peptidic scorpion toxins found in the SWISSPROT and PIR databases using the search engine of the felix.EMBL-Heidelberg.de computer (European Molecular Biology Laboratory, Heidelberg, Germany.
